### Runbook: Report export timezone mismatches (Glimmerfield)

If a customer reports that exported totals differ from the dashboard, check whether their report schedule predates the March cutover — older schedules still render in server-local time rather than the account timezone. Re-saving the schedule fixes it. Before escalating, confirm the export worker is running with the expected timezone settings shown below.

config for kadup-kajog:
[raldor]
host = raldor.tolvaqworks.internal
user = raldor_svc
database = raldor_prod

Subject: Consent banner rollout — heads up, plugin folks

Hi all — the new Fernwhistle consent banner goes live in next week's release. If your plugin injects UI into the footer region, test against the staging build, since the banner now claims that slot on first load. Most plugins should be unaffected. The staging build you'll want is stamped with the token below.

session token of tajef-bageg = htk21_5d90d574934f3ccae6437

### Step 4 — Redeploy the Feed Validator

After migrating the Castwright database, redeploy the Plumefeed validator so it picks up the new episode-schema checks. The validator refuses to start if the schema version in its config lags the database, so confirm both before paging anyone. Rollback simply redeploys the prior image. The validator should start with the configuration values shown below.

deployment values, kajep-kageg:
[praix]
host = praix.paliqcorp.corp
user = praix_svc
database = praix_prod

Subject: Quickstore 4.2 — bloom filter now fronts the KV layer

Plugin authors: starting with this release, Quickstore places a bloom filter ahead of the key-value store. Negative lookups return faster; false positives fall through safely. No API changes are required on your side. Verify your plugin against the staging build referenced below.

session token of fahif-tadup = htk3_9c7